Class RegistryEntryArgumentType.Serializer<T>

java.lang.Object
net.minecraft.command.argument.RegistryEntryArgumentType.Serializer<T>
All Implemented Interfaces:
ArgumentSerializer<RegistryEntryArgumentType<T>,RegistryEntryArgumentType.Serializer<T>.Properties>
Enclosing class:
RegistryEntryArgumentType<T>

public static class RegistryEntryArgumentType.Serializer<T> extends Object implements ArgumentSerializer<RegistryEntryArgumentType<T>,RegistryEntryArgumentType.Serializer<T>.Properties>
Mappings:
Namespace Name
official el$a
intermediary net/minecraft/class_7733$class_7734
named net/minecraft/command/argument/RegistryEntryArgumentType$Serializer
  • Constructor Details

    • Serializer

      public Serializer()
  • Method Details

    • method_45614

      public void method_45614(RegistryEntryArgumentType.Serializer<T>.Properties serializer, PacketByteBuf packetByteBuf)
      Mappings:
      Namespace Name Mixin selector
      official a Lel$a;a(Lel$a$a;Lrt;)V
      intermediary method_45614 Lnet/minecraft/class_7733$class_7734;method_45614(Lnet/minecraft/class_7733$class_7734$class_7735;Lnet/minecraft/class_2540;)V
      named method_45614 Lnet/minecraft/command/argument/RegistryEntryArgumentType$Serializer;method_45614(Lnet/minecraft/command/argument/RegistryEntryArgumentType$Serializer$Properties;Lnet/minecraft/network/PacketByteBuf;)V
    • method_45616

      public RegistryEntryArgumentType.Serializer<T>.Properties method_45616(PacketByteBuf packetByteBuf)
      Mappings:
      Namespace Name Mixin selector
      official a Lel$a;a(Lrt;)Lel$a$a;
      intermediary method_45616 Lnet/minecraft/class_7733$class_7734;method_45616(Lnet/minecraft/class_2540;)Lnet/minecraft/class_7733$class_7734$class_7735;
      named method_45616 Lnet/minecraft/command/argument/RegistryEntryArgumentType$Serializer;method_45616(Lnet/minecraft/network/PacketByteBuf;)Lnet/minecraft/command/argument/RegistryEntryArgumentType$Serializer$Properties;
    • method_45613

      public void method_45613(RegistryEntryArgumentType.Serializer<T>.Properties serializer, JsonObject jsonObject)
      Mappings:
      Namespace Name Mixin selector
      official a Lel$a;a(Lel$a$a;Lcom/google/gson/JsonObject;)V
      intermediary method_45613 Lnet/minecraft/class_7733$class_7734;method_45613(Lnet/minecraft/class_7733$class_7734$class_7735;Lcom/google/gson/JsonObject;)V
      named method_45613 Lnet/minecraft/command/argument/RegistryEntryArgumentType$Serializer;method_45613(Lnet/minecraft/command/argument/RegistryEntryArgumentType$Serializer$Properties;Lcom/google/gson/JsonObject;)V
    • method_45615

      public RegistryEntryArgumentType.Serializer<T>.Properties method_45615(RegistryEntryArgumentType<T> registryEntryArgumentType)
      Mappings:
      Namespace Name Mixin selector
      official a Lel$a;a(Lel;)Lel$a$a;
      intermediary method_45615 Lnet/minecraft/class_7733$class_7734;method_45615(Lnet/minecraft/class_7733;)Lnet/minecraft/class_7733$class_7734$class_7735;
      named method_45615 Lnet/minecraft/command/argument/RegistryEntryArgumentType$Serializer;method_45615(Lnet/minecraft/command/argument/RegistryEntryArgumentType;)Lnet/minecraft/command/argument/RegistryEntryArgumentType$Serializer$Properties;